QpiAI is a cutting-edge technology company that specializes in integrating quantum computing and artificial intelligence for enterprise applications. Established in 2019 by Nagendra Nagaraja, QpiAI is headquartered in Bengaluru, India. As of July 2025, the company has successfully raised a total of $43.3 million across three funding rounds, with key participation from the Indian government's National Quantum Mission and investment firms such as Avataar Ventures and YourNest.

QpiAI was founded in 2019 with the ambitious goal of merging quantum computing with artificial intelligence to solve complex industrial problems. The company was initiated by Dr. Nagendra Nagaraja, a visionary in the field, focusing on leveraging quantum mechanics and AI to accelerate computation speeds and enhance data analytics. The startup quickly gained attention within the tech community for its innovative approach, and by 2020, it had already begun developing a suite of AI-driven quantum computing tools and applications tailored for industries such as healthcare, finance, and logistics.
QpiAI integrates quantum computing into AI models to improve computational power for industrial applications. It has developed a suite of proprietary software platforms, such as QpiAI-Pro and QpiAI-Explorer, which cater to a diverse range of sectors, including life sciences and materials discovery. The company’s business model revolves around providing enterprise-grade quantum computing solutions that can be accessed as a cloud service, fostering a greater reach for computational resources previously unavailable to many industries.
